BioWare Announces N7 Day Plans

November 2, 2015 by Michael Fossbakk

Don’t expect big news on Mass Effect: Andromeda.

BioWare has announced their plans for N7 Day, a day of celebration among fans of BioWare’s Mass Effect series of video games.

N7 Day is held every year on Nov. 7 and this year BioWare is highlighting the day with a livestream from the developers to support Extra Life, a charity where participants raise money for children’s hospitals around the United States. The livestream will be hosted on BioWare’s Twitch channel and they will be playing Mass Effect 3’s Citadel DLC. Additionally, they will be taking suggestions from the audience as to what decisions the community would like for Commander Shepherd to make in this playthrough of the 2013 add-on. BioWare will also be matching every dollar raised through the livestream up to $10,000.

BioWare teased, “[W]hile we won’t have any major announcements for Mass Effect: Andromeda this N7 Day, keep an eye out on Saturday for some surprises that we’re sure you’ll enjoy.”

The developer will also be sharing social media posts from fans on Facebook, Twitter, Instagram, etc. and will be giving away free stuff on the BioWare and Mass Effect Twitter accounts. Additionally, items will be on sale in the BioWare store in “a week-long N7 Day Celebration Sale.”

The next entry in the Mass Effect franchise, Mass Effect: Andromeda, was announced at E3 2015 for release at the end of 2016. More details for the game’s story and characters can be found here.
